Workflow Name Description
Create a permission Provides a sample script that interacts with the authorization client and permission service to
create a new permission in vCloud Automation Center.
Create a tenant Creates a tenant with the same vCAC host and Identity Store configuration as the default tenant.
To run this workflow, select the vCAC host added with system administrator credentials. You can
change the Identity Store settings before running the workflow.
List catalog items Returns a list of catalog items for the selected tenant.
Access the vCloud Automation Center Plug-In API
Orchestrator provides an API Explorer to allow you to search the vCloud Automation Center plug-in API
and see the documentation for JavaScript objects that you can use in scripted elements.
For updated vCloud Automation Center API documentation, see
https://www.vmware.com/support/pubs/vcac-pubs.html.
Procedure
1 Log in to the Orchestrator client as an administrator.
2 Select Tools > API Explorer.
3 Double-click the vCAC and VCACCAFE modules in the left pane to expand the hierarchical list of
vCloud Automation Center plug-in API objects.
What to do next
You can copy code from API elements and paste it into scripting boxes. For more information about API
scripting, see Developing with VMware vCenter Orchestrator.
